Velavadar (Blackbuck National Park) season by season

Winter December to February Prime time

Dec-Mar is peak: hundreds of blackbuck on open grass and one of the world's largest harrier roosts at dusk.

Summer March to May Prime time

Apr-May bakes at 43 °C on shadeless grassland; safaris run at dawn only, then the gates shut for the rains in June.

Monsoon June to September Do not go

Shut through the rains for blackbuck and lesser florican breeding, and the black-cotton grass turns to gluey mud.

Autumn October to November Shoulder

Gates reopen mid-October onto green grass and no visitors; harrier numbers build through November into the roost.

What Velavadar (Blackbuck National Park) is actually like

Almost no independent travellers; a four-room forest guesthouse or one costly lodge, and you need a jeep

Getting to Velavadar (Blackbuck National Park)

Bhavnagar railhead 65 km, Vallabhipur bus stand 32 km, then hire a jeep out to the park gate
